Call For Symposia
The lndian Wildlife Ecology Conference 2026 is delighted to invite
submission for symposia proposals for the upcoming conference scheduled for 10-12th July, 2026, at Ashoka University, Sonipat. The symposia will reflect the broad goals of the conference, which is to bring together researchers of Indian wildlife ecology to discuss contemporary and emerging issues in wildlife ecology, share research, forge collaborations, and ideate future directions.
Symposium proposals may be in the following formats:
- A symposium will last 100-140 minutes with 4-6 presentations, each of 20 minutes including discussion. We expect that symposia with 4 speakers will be 100 minutes and those with 6 speakers will be 140 minutes. Chairs may have a synthesis session or discussion before and/or after the talks, at their discretion.
- Alternatively, symposia can be proposed as a 60-minute IGNITE-style session with 5-minute talks of 20 slides that advance automatically every 15 seconds to inspire the exchange of new and exciting ideas. Any IGNITE-style session may have a maximum of 10 speakers, and chairs may have a synthesis session before and/or after the talks, at their discretion. While there will be no time for Q & A for each talk, the session will be linked to the poster session, where the presenters may engage with conference participants on their presentation. Only 10% of all symposia will be IGNITE-style sessions.

All sessions will be supported by a student volunteer from IWEC, who will assist speakers with slide loading, provide time signals, and facilitate Q&A. The session chair and co-chair(s) will be responsible for moderating discussions during the symposium.
